I don't use Facebook. Never felt the need to reconnect with chumps. I like my privacy. I dislike the need by individuals to be the total center of attention all the time. Blame reality tv. Everyone wants to be a star.
There was a case in canada, where a woman was on disability leave for depression. Her doctor told her to get some fun and excitment. So she and friends went to the tropics. Pics were posted on facebook with privacy settings. Her boss got wind of her trip with pics of her smiling and all. Her disability payments were cancelled since she's well enough to go on a trip and have a great time. The case is going to court. |
